🙂A single person spends $950 per month in Chiang Mai vs $1,235 in Buraydah,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,430 per month in Chiang Mai vs $2,064 in Buraydah,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$1,909 per month in Chiang Mai vs $2,893 in Buraydah, rent included.
🙂Chiang Mai is about 23% cheaper than Buraydah,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.
📊Both Chiang Mai and Buraydah are more affordable than the global median – Chiang Mai31% lower, Buraydah10% lower.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$484 in Chiang Mai versus $694 in Buraydah.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 314% higher in Buraydah,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$20.00 in Chiang Mai versus $40.00 in Buraydah. Groceries tell a different story – $242 in Chiang Mai vs $205 in Buraydah – so Buraydah w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
